Idaho · 2026

H 630

AIRBORNE CONTROL OF PREDATORY ANIMALS – Amends existing law to provide for shooting of coyotes, wolves, and red foxes from aircraft.

Roll-call votes on this bill

QuestionChamberResultYeaNayOtherDateSource
Read third time in full – upper fail 6 28 1 Mar 25, 2026 Open States bulk CSV (bills/votes) CC0-1.0
Read Third Time in Full – lower pass 55 7 2 Feb 24, 2026 Open States bulk CSV (bills/votes) CC0-1.0
